[发明专利]延迟响应控制方法有效
申请号: | 201911248863.X | 申请日: | 2019-12-09 |
公开(公告)号: | CN111162930B | 公开(公告)日: | 2022-11-11 |
发明(设计)人: | 邵宛岩;范渊;刘博;龙文洁 | 申请(专利权)人: | 杭州安恒信息技术股份有限公司 |
主分类号: | H04L41/0823 | 分类号: | H04L41/0823;H04L41/0604;G06F16/951 |
代理公司: | 杭州中成专利事务所有限公司 33212 | 代理人: | 金祺;周世骏 |
地址: | 310051 浙江省*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 延迟 响应 控制 方法 | ||
本发明提供一种延迟响应控制方法,包括以下步骤:配置应用服务IP、端口;根据步骤1配置的IP、端口,通过爬虫爬取应用服务中的模块及url;根据步骤2爬取应用服务中的模块及url得到爬虫结果;将步骤3得到的爬取结果进行过滤,去除访问类型为请求的爬虫结果,获取响应类请求;根据步骤4中获取到的响应类请求及爬取时间,生成响应类请求的响应时间阈值T:根据步骤5得到的响应时间阈值T,设置响应规则,得到响应浮动时间;根据步骤6得到的响应规则和响应浮动时间,得到页面指标:根据响应时间阈值T、响应浮动时间、页面指标来进行响应控制。本发明在不影响用户体验的情况下,对非常态或失败请求,配置合理的延迟响应时间。
技术领域
本发明涉及一种网络技术,具体涉及一种延迟响应控制方法。
背景技术
互联网给人们生活带来便捷,与此同时一些给人们带来便利的应用服务,特别部署于网络上的,或因某些特殊需求或因某些攻击者不停请求从而导致应用不能为用户正常提供服务。比如网络上有很多爬虫在对网站的url不停的抓数据或者非正常访问,导致网络拥塞,影响正常的使用。比如数据窃取,尤其是大量下载大文件的请求;比如暴力破解,大量请求登陆。这些非正常使用都越来越高级,越来越难识别。
现有技术存在以下问题:
1、目前采用都是监测、检测手段发现后进行告警,这些通常是事后发现、事后处理的办法。
缺陷:非正常使用都越来越高级,越来越难识别,仍然会造成赌塞,使得应用不能提供正常服务。
2、通过策略防火墙匹配成功后,进行阻拦。
缺陷:可能会造成误判,而影响用户体验。
因此,需要对现有技术进行改进。
发明内容
本发明要解决的技术问题是提供一种高效的延迟响应控制方法。
为解决上述技术问题,本发明提供一种延迟响应控制方法,包括以下步骤:
1)、配置应用服务IP、端口;
2)、根据步骤1配置的IP、端口,通过爬虫爬取应用服务中的模块及url;
3)、根据步骤2爬取应用服务中的模块及url得到爬虫结果;
4)、将步骤3得到的爬取结果进行过滤,去除访问类型为请求的爬虫结果,获取响应类请求;
5)、根据步骤4中获取到的响应类请求及爬取时间,生成响应类请求的响应时间阈值T:
6)、根据步骤5得到的响应时间阈值T,设置响应规则,得到响应浮动时间;
7)、根据步骤6得到的响应规则和响应浮动时间,得到页面指标:
8)、根据响应时间阈值T、响应浮动时间、页面指标来进行响应控制。
作为对本发明延迟响应控制方法的改进:
在步骤3中,爬虫结果包含但不限于url、访问类型、爬取时间、详情;访问类型包含但不限于请求/响应。
作为对本发明延迟响应控制方法的进一步改进:
步骤5包括:
5.1)、通过步骤4中获取到的响应类请求及爬取时间,得到以响应类请求为横坐标,爬取时间为纵坐标的分布图;通过观测分布图,以步骤4得到的响应类请求中爬取时间中的最大值,作为最大的响应时间t,能获取到最大的响应时间t;
5.2)、重复执行步骤2-4,获取到n个最大的响应时间t;
5.3)、将n个最大的响应时间t,进行均值得到响应时间阈值T。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于杭州安恒信息技术股份有限公司,未经杭州安恒信息技术股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911248863.X/2.html,转载请声明来源钻瓜专利网。
- 上一篇:航线收益管理方法及系统
- 下一篇:航线收益管理方法及系统